Understanding these details helps you make informed decisions about whether to repair or replace the module and what to expect during service.<\/p>\n<\/div>\n<div class=\"info-section\">\n<h2>What the PCM Does in a 2005 Buick Rainier<\/h2>\n<p>The PCM\/ECM in your 2005 Buick Rainier functions as the central brain of the 4.2L engine, continuously monitoring sensor inputs and adjusting fuel delivery, ignition timing, emissions systems, and transmission shift points in real time. This integrated computer processes data from the crankshaft position sensor, camshaft position sensor, throttle position sensor, and numerous other inputs to make instantaneous decisions about engine operation. When the internal processor or memory becomes corrupted, communication with the vehicle&#8217;s systems breaks down and the engine may not run properly. <a href=\"https:\/\/www.fs1inc.com\/gm\/buick-pcm-ecm-ecu-engine-computer\/rainier-engine-computers.html\">replacement engine computers for the Rainier<\/a> must be programmed with your specific VIN and configuration data to function correctly. Without proper programming, the engine may not start at all or will run poorly with multiple drivability issues.<\/p>\n<\/div>\n<div class=\"info-section\">\n<h2>Where the PCM Is Located and What Replacement Involves<\/h2>\n<p>The PCM\/ECM on the 2005 Buick Rainier is located at the intake manifold, requiring removal of surrounding components for access. The intake manifold must be partially removed to reach the module, making this a more involved repair than on some other vehicles.<\/p>\n<figure style=\"margin:22px auto;text-align:center;max-width:720px\"><img decoding=\"async\" style=\"max-width:100%;height:auto;border:1px solid #e2e6ec;border-radius:8px\" src=\"https:\/\/www.fs1inc.com\/blog\/wp-content\/uploads\/2026\/07\/2005-buick-rainier-pcm-location-diagram.webp\" alt=\"2005 Buick Rainier PCM location diagram\" loading=\"lazy\"\/><figcaption style=\"font-size:13px;color:#667085;margin-top:8px\">PCM mounting location on the 2005 Buick Rainier.<\/figcaption><\/figure>\n<div style=\"background:#f7f9fc;border:1px solid #e2e8f2;border-radius:10px;padding:18px 24px;margin:18px 0\">\n<h3 style='margin-top:0'>How to Reach the PCM on the 2005 Buick Rainier<\/h3>\n<ol style=\"margin:14px 0 6px 0;padding-left:26px\">\n<li style=\"margin:10px 0;line-height:1.65\"><b>Remove<\/b> any debris from around the control module connector.<\/li>\n<li style=\"margin:10px 0;line-height:1.65\"><b>Loosen<\/b> the PCM harness connector bolts from.<\/li>\n<li style=\"margin:10px 0;line-height:1.65\"><b>Remove<\/b> the PCM harness connectors from the.<\/li>\n<li style=\"margin:10px 0;line-height:1.65\"><b>Remove<\/b> the PCM retaining bolts and.<\/li>\n<li style=\"margin:10px 0;line-height:1.65\"><b>Slide<\/b> the PCM away from the intake manifold.<\/li>\n<li style=\"margin:10px 0;line-height:1.65\"><b>Remove<\/b> the PCM mounting studs from the intake.<\/li>\n<\/ol>\n<p style='margin:10px 0 0 0'><em>Work with the ignition off, and treat the module as static-sensitive: avoid touching the connector pins at any point.<\/em><\/p>\n<\/div>\n<table style=\"width:100%;border-collapse:collapse;margin:18px 0;font-size:15px\">\n<tr>\n<th style=\"border:1px solid #d6dbe3;background:#f2f5f9;padding:9px 12px;text-align:left\">Operation<\/th>\n<th style=\"border:1px solid #d6dbe3;background:#f2f5f9;padding:9px 12px;text-align:left\">Configuration<\/th>\n<th style=\"border:1px solid #d6dbe3;background:#f2f5f9;padding:9px 12px;text-align:left\">Book Time<\/th>\n<\/tr>\n<tr>\n<td style=\"border:1px solid #d6dbe3;padding:9px 12px\">Powertrain Control Module Relearn<\/td>\n<td style=\"border:1px solid #d6dbe3;padding:9px 12px\">All configurations<\/td>\n<td style=\"border:1px solid #d6dbe3;padding:9px 12px\">0.5 hr<\/td>\n<\/tr>\n<tr>\n<td style=\"border:1px solid #d6dbe3;padding:9px 12px\">Powertrain Control Module R&amp;R<\/td>\n<td style=\"border:1px solid #d6dbe3;padding:9px 12px\">All configurations<\/td>\n<td style=\"border:1px solid #d6dbe3;padding:9px 12px\">1.4 hr<\/td>\n<\/tr>\n<tr>\n<td style=\"border:1px solid #d6dbe3;padding:9px 12px\">Engine Control Module Relearn<\/td>\n<td style=\"border:1px solid #d6dbe3;padding:9px 12px\">All configurations<\/td>\n<td style=\"border:1px solid #d6dbe3;padding:9px 12px\">0.5 hr<\/td>\n<\/tr>\n<tr>\n<td style=\"border:1px solid #d6dbe3;padding:9px 12px\">Engine Control Module Reset<\/td>\n<td style=\"border:1px solid #d6dbe3;padding:9px 12px\">All configurations<\/td>\n<td style=\"border:1px solid #d6dbe3;padding:9px 12px\">0.3 hr<\/td>\n<\/tr>\n<tr>\n<td style=\"border:1px solid #d6dbe3;padding:9px 12px\">Engine Control Module R&amp;R<\/td>\n<td style=\"border:1px solid #d6dbe3;padding:9px 12px\">All configurations<\/td>\n<td style=\"border:1px solid #d6dbe3;padding:9px 12px\">1.4 hr<\/td>\n<\/tr>\n<\/table>\n<\/div>\n<div class=\"info-section\">\n<h2>Programming Requirements After Replacement<\/h2>\n<p>The factory procedure requires using a scan tool to capture the ECM data before removing the old module, then restoring that captured data into the new ECM after installation. This step preserves vehicle-specific information including the remaining engine oil life\u2014if this data is not transferred, the oil life monitor will default to 100 percent and give a false reading of the oil&#8217;s remaining service life. Flagship One units arrive as <a href=\"https:\/\/www.fs1inc.com\/2005-buick-rainier-4-2l-engine-computer-pcm-ecm-ecu-programmed-plug-play.html\">a VIN-programmed replacement unit<\/a>, meaning the programming is completed before the unit ships so you avoid the data-capture step that would otherwise be required at the dealership.<\/p>\n<\/div>\n<div class=\"info-section\">\n<h2>Symptoms of a Failing PCM<\/h2>\n<p>When the PCM\/ECM fails on your 2005 Buick Rainier, you may experience no-start conditions where the engine cranks but will not fire, or the vehicle may stall unexpectedly during operation. The check engine light typically illuminates with module-internal trouble codes stored in memory. You might notice rough idle, poor acceleration, or hesitation under throttle as the module loses the ability to properly control fuel delivery and ignition timing. Transmission shifting may become harsh or the vehicle could have difficulty shifting gears. Scan-tool communication often fails entirely when the module has experienced internal failure. <a href=\"https:\/\/www.fs1inc.com\/blog\/dtc-p0601-internal-control-module-memory-checksum-error\/\">internal memory failure<\/a> represents one common code indicating the module has lost integrity of its internal memory, while codes P0602 through P0604 indicate similar processor and memory faults.<\/p>\n<\/div>\n<div class=\"info-section\">\n<h2>Module Trouble Codes on the 2005 Buick Rainier<\/h2>\n<p>The 2005 Buick Rainier may store module-internal trouble codes when the PCM or ECM experiences internal failure. These codes indicate specific processor or memory problems within the control module itself rather than failures in external sensors or wiring. The documented codes for this vehicle include P0601 through P0607 and P060E for processor and memory faults, P062F for ROM failure, and codes P1600, P1621, P1627, P1681, and P1683 for various class=\"info-section\">\n<h2>Factory Service Bulletins Worth Knowing<\/h2>\n<p>Two factory service bulletins pertain to the 2005 Buick Rainier&#8217;s control module. Bulletin #04-07-30-041, issued in October 2004, addresses customer complaints of harsh shift conditions, inoperative cruise control, or an illuminated Service Engine Soon light, with PCM reprogramming as the recommended fix. Bulletin #05-06-04-060, issued in September 2005, covers module-internal DTCs P0601, P0602, P0603, P0604, and P1621 that may appear across multiple control modules including the PCM, ECM, and TCM.
